Fumba Beach Lodge - Zanzibar (south west coast)
Fumba Beach Lodge is the ultimate hideaway for guests who want relaxation. Guest rooms are scattered within 40 acres of baobab and palm wilderness with three naturally sheltered beaches providing a cool sea breeze.
Conveniently located 30 minutes southwest of Zanzibar’s historic capital, Stone Town, but well hidden from the busy tourist areas, Fumba Beach Lodge is the perfect venue for enjoying the peace and tranquility of this tropical island paradise.

Each spacious room has an en-suite bathroom, private terrace and a stunning ocean view. All rooms are suitable for families, couples or individuals.
A comfortable open-air restaurant serves the freshest seafood and expertly prepared international or traditional cuisine.
The unique beach bar, constructed from an authentic Zanzibari dhow, is situated under an enormous baobab on a seaside cliff - a magnificent idyllic setting to watch the sun go down.
Fumba Beach Lodge offers guests the ultimate in relaxing massage. The Baobab Massage Centrex has been built around a majestic African Baobab tree boasting a six meter high platform with a Jacuzzi in the tree itself overlooking the gardens and the Indian Ocean in the distance.
Menai Bay Conservation Area
Menai Bay has been dedicated as a conservation area since 1998 due to its outstanding natural beauty. Established by the World Wildlife Federation (WWF), Menai Bay Conservation Area was designed to give Zanzibaris in the Fumba area a vested interest in their environment so they will protect it. The project is aimed at teaching villagers how to conserve their natural heritage, and how to profitably exploit it in a sustainable manner. Eco-tourism plays an important role in that profitability and Fumba Beach Lodge is the first and only lodge offering accommodation on the pristine Fumba Peninsula.
